1968 A/C small block, 4-speed with a/c. It does not have the idle solenoid set-up. I emailed the seller and his response:
Hello Bryan. I checked for the solenoid and found none... nor any bracket... nor any wire that may have once powered such a device. Your question made me wonder ? and my curiosity culminated into a call to the gentleman that appraised the car in hopes of an answer. To the best of his knowledge (which is quite extensive) and after consulting M F Dobbins, "VETTEVUES FACT BOOK OF THE 1968-1972 STINGRAY", he was quite convinced that the idle solenoid had not yet been used in the 1968 Stingray. Although the book had no reference to the 1968 being outfitted with the solenoid in any of the text or in any of the photos of original '68 engines, and the appraiser's recall of the use (or non-use) of the solenoid reflects that of the book, the appraiser did say that nothing's for sure when it comes the the '68 and its many changes throughout the production year.
